Transaction 63f8b51cdeb6236f9a1d2dd68700fb7cb991b8c240e9753923940d2ff1851e36

2 Input
2 Outputs
  • 63f8b51cdeb6236f9a1d2dd68700fb7cb991b8c240e9753923940d2ff1851e36:0
  • value  999312
    address  3CxcCx8MET86WjLHXSVYk9VrRDUQU5ZFLC
  • 63f8b51cdeb6236f9a1d2dd68700fb7cb991b8c240e9753923940d2ff1851e36:1
  • value  160000
    address  32E3jHuSWVuXz6mJFwvRrXpS9FjgGz82Jb